One of the core principles explored is self-awareness. Emotional resilience begins with recognizing your own emotional patterns—how you respond to frustration, criticism, and uncertainty. Through exercises and reflection techniques, this guide teaches you to identify triggers, assess your automatic reactions, and develop strategies to redirect your energy constructively. You’ll learn not only to survive stressful situations but to harness them, turning tension into a driving force for productivity and innovation.

Building resilience also means cultivating emotional regulation skills. This book introduces practical methods for managing intense emotions, from mindfulness practices and breathing techniques to cognitive reframing strategies that shift your perspective. You’ll discover how to pause before reacting, allowing thoughtful responses to replace impulsive reactions. Over time, these habits become second nature, creating a professional presence that inspires confidence in colleagues and superiors alike.
